FAQs About Paris Cruises

1. What should I wear on a Paris cruise?

The outfit largely depends on the cruise’s nature. If you opt for a formal dinner cruise, business casual or formal attire is best. For daytime tours, comfortable casual wear is suitable.

2. Are there meal options available during the cruise?

Many cruise packages include dining options, ranging from light snacks to gourmet dinners. It’s best to check with the provider for specific offerings.

3. How long do Paris cruises typically last?

The duration varies; shorter tours might last an hour, while more comprehensive options, like dinner cruises, can extend to several hours.
